The P-Shot (Priapus Shot) has become a highly sought-after treatment for men looking to improve erectile dysfunction, enhance sexual performance, and rejuvenate their sexual health. Using platelet-rich plasma (PRP) derived from a patient’s own blood, the P-Shot stimulates tissue regeneration, improves blood flow, and enhances overall sexual function. 1. Look for a Licensed and Experienced Professional
The most important factor when choosing a provider for your P-Shot is ensuring that they are a licensed healthcare professional with specialized experience in administering PRP treatments. While the procedure is non-surgical, it still involves a high degree of precision, as the PRP must be injected into specific areas of the penis to be effective.
Here are some key qualifications to look for in your provider:
Medical Background: Ideally, your provider should be a licensed urologist, dermatologist, or cosmetic surgeon who has expertise in regenerative medicine, sexual health, or men’s health. Some providers may also be trained in stem cell therapy or other advanced treatments that complement the P-Shot.
Experience with PRP: While the P-Shot is a popular treatment, not every doctor has experience with the specific technique and nuances required for optimal results. Look for a provider who has a proven track record of successfully administering PRP injections, particularly for erectile dysfunction or other sexual health issues.
Board Certification: Check if the provider is board-certified in their field. Board certification ensures that the doctor has undergone the necessary training, testing, and continuing education to offer high-quality care. A board-certified urologist or specialist in sexual health will have the expertise to evaluate your condition and administer the P-Shot safely.

4. Clinic Environment and Technology
The environment in which your treatment is performed plays a crucial role in your overall experience. When choosing a provider, take note of the following factors related to the clinic:
Clean and Professional Setting: The clinic should be clean, organized, and well-maintained. A reputable provider will ensure that the facility meets all health and safety regulations. It should be equipped with state-of-the-art medical equipment for PRP processing, as the quality of the PRP is critical to the success of the treatment.
Sterility and Safety Protocols: Ensure that the clinic follows sterility protocols and maintains high hygiene standards. PRP is derived from your own blood, but contamination during the extraction, processing, or injection stages can affect the treatment's effectiveness and safety. The provider should follow strict sanitation practices to minimize any risk of infection.
Advanced Technology: PRP therapy requires specialized equipment for blood collection, centrifugation (to separate the platelets), and the injection process. The provider should use cutting-edge technology to ensure that the PRP is processed effectively, maximizing the growth factors available for tissue regeneration.
5. Cost Transparency and Payment Options
While cost should not be the primary factor in choosing a provider, it’s important to understand the financial aspects of the P-Shot treatment. Prices can vary significantly based on location, provider experience, and the clinic’s reputation.
Cost Range: On average, the P-Shot can cost anywhere from $1,500 to $2,500 per session. Some clinics may offer package deals or discounts for multiple treatments, but be cautious of providers who offer the treatment at unusually low prices, as this could indicate subpar quality or lack of experience.
Financing Options: Some providers offer financing options or payment plans to help patients manage the cost of treatment. If cost is a concern, inquire about the available financing options and whether your provider works with medical credit programs like CareCredit.
Insurance Coverage: Unfortunately, the P-Shot is typically not covered by insurance, as it is considered an elective or cosmetic treatment. However, you should confirm this with the provider beforehand to avoid any surprises.
